Output 64ae2bd0a0b214d005f04932c8d75b27ce165e5a8fd77f1bf61bee60fc649338:0

value
26435307
script pubkey
OP_0 OP_PUSHBYTES_20 577572a3ccbfd4ba7f9810563170f251505a0e8c
address
bc1q2a6h9g7vhl2t5luczptrzu8j29g95r5vw2xwl0
transaction
64ae2bd0a0b214d005f04932c8d75b27ce165e5a8fd77f1bf61bee60fc649338
spent
true